Bears starting QB got benched, their top two RBs are out (one.on IR and the other on Covid-19 list)... and their OL sucks... but their QB is extremely mobile.

I kinda want to blitz the hell out of their offense, to give their backfield (with a rookie QB and rookie RB) the least amount of time possible to find an open target, either consistently sending 5 guys or sending 4 with a designated spy just following the mobile QB when he runs.

Yes, this could potentially lead to giving up more big plays... but they'll have less time to get those big plays and less communication will be needed with the DBs as it's less zone and more single coverage, and maybe one deep Safety (Savage) to hopefully stop TDs (and yes he got burnt last week with that, but hopefully he's learned and the Bears QB mit not be as good as the Bengals QB, and I certainly don't think his OL/RB are...

But go heavy aggressive at their OL and backfield, and try not to give them time to pick on our CBs.
